The boundaries of the designated Nature Conservation MPAs provided in this dataset represent the final recommendations within both the 12 nautical mile Territorial Sea limit (on the basis of advice provided by Scottish Natural Heritage - the Scottish Government's adviser on all aspects of nature and landscape across Scotland) and in the UK offshore waters adjacent to Scotland (on the basis of advice provided by the Joint Nature Conservation Committee- the statutory adviser to UK Government and devolved administrations on UK-wide and international nature conservation).

A suite of 30 Nature Conservation MPAs (MPAs) were designated by Scottish Ministers on the 24th July, 2014.

A further site West of Scotland MPA managed by JNCC was designated by ministers on 25th September 2020.

Four additional Nature Conservation MPAs were designated by Scottish Ministers on the 3rd December 2020.

Red Rocks and Longay (Urgent ncMPA) was designated by Scottish Ministers on t 10th March 2021.
